Earthwork grading services involve shaping and leveling the ground to prepare a property for construction, landscaping, or drainage improvements. This process typically includ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and contouring the land to achieve the desired slope and elevation. Proper grading ensures that water flows away from structures and prevents pooling or erosion, which can cause damage over time. Skilled contractors may use specialized equipment such as bulldozers, graders, and compactors to achieve precise results that meet the specific needs of each project.
These services help address common problems associated with poorly graded land, such as improper drainage, soil erosion, and uneven surfaces. Without adequate grading, water may collect around foundations, leading to potential flooding or structural issues. Additionally, uneven terrain can make landscaping or construction work more difficult and less stable. Earthwork grading helps create a stable, well-drained foundation that minimizes future maintenance needs and enhances the safety and usability of outdoor spaces.

Labor Costs - The cost for labor typically ranges from $50 to $100 per hour for earthwork grading services. Total labor expenses depend on project size and complexity, often totaling between $1,500 and $5,000 for medium-sized sites.
Equipment Expenses - Equipment rental fees can vary from $200 to $1,000 per day, depending on the machinery needed such as graders, bulldozers, or excavators. Larger projects may require multiple pieces of equipment, increasing overall costs.
Material Costs - Materials like fill dirt or gravel can add $10 to $30 per cubic yard to the project cost. For example, filling a 100 cubic yard area might cost between $1,000 and $3,000 in materials alone.
Permits and Miscellaneous Fees - Permit costs for earthwork grading services generally range from $100 to $500, varying by location and project scope. Additional fees may include site assessments or inspection charges, influencing the overall budget.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
